fa6a20c874 drm/v3d: Address race-condition between per-fd GPU stats and fd release
When the file descriptor is closed while a job is still running,
there's a race condition between the job completion callback and the
file descriptor cleanup. This can lead to accessing freed memory when
updating per-fd GPU stats, such as the following example:

Fix such an issue by protecting all accesses to `job->file_priv` with
the queue's lock. With that, we can clear `job->file_priv` before the
V3D per-fd structure is freed and assure that `job->file_priv` exists
during the per-fd GPU stats updates.

e9d8e02748 drm/v3d: Replace a global spinlock with a per-queue spinlock
Each V3D queue works independently and all the dependencies between the
jobs are handled through the DRM scheduler. Therefore, there is no need
to use one single lock for all queues. Using it, creates unnecessary
contention between different queues that can operate independently.

Replace the global spinlock with per-queue locks to improve parallelism
and reduce contention between different V3D queues (BIN, RENDER, TFU,
CSD). This allows independent queues to operate concurrently while
maintaining proper synchronization within each queue.

e7fa80e293 drm_gem: add mutex to drm_gem_object.gpuva
There are two main ways that GPUVM might be used:

* staged mode, where VM_BIND ioctls update the GPUVM immediately so that
  the GPUVM reflects the state of the VM *including* staged changes that
  are not yet applied to the GPU's virtual address space.
* immediate mode, where the GPUVM state is updated during run_job(),
  i.e., in the DMA fence signalling critical path, to ensure that the
  GPUVM and the GPU's virtual address space has the same state at all
  times.

Currently, only Panthor uses GPUVM in immediate mode, but the Rust
drivers Tyr and Nova will also use GPUVM in immediate mode, so it is
worth to support both staged and immediate mode well in GPUVM. To use
immediate mode, the GEMs gpuva list must be modified during the fence
signalling path, which means that it must be protected by a lock that is
fence signalling safe.

For this reason, a mutex is added to struct drm_gem_object that is
intended to achieve this purpose. Adding it directly in the GEM object
both makes it easier to use GPUVM in immediate mode, but also makes it
possible to take the gpuva lock from core drm code.

As a follow-up, another change that should probably be made to support
immediate mode is a mechanism to postpone cleanup of vm_bo objects, as
dropping a vm_bo object in the fence signalling path is problematic for
two reasons:

* When using DRM_GPUVM_RESV_PROTECTED, you cannot remove the vm_bo from
  the extobj/evicted lists during the fence signalling path.
* Dropping a vm_bo could lead to the GEM object getting destroyed.
  The requirement that GEM object cleanup is fence signalling safe is
  dubious and likely to be violated in practice.

Panthor already has its own custom implementation of postponing vm_bo
cleanup.

81a45cb7ea drm/xe/migrate: make MI_TLB_INVALIDATE conditional
When clearing VRAM we should be able to skip invalidating the TLBs if we
are only using the identity map to access VRAM (which is the common
case), since no modifications are made to PTEs on the fly. Also since we
use huge 1G entries within the identity map, there should be a pretty
decent chance that the next packet(s) (if also clears) can avoid a tree
walk if we don't shoot down the TLBs, like if we have to process a long
stream of clears.

For normal moves/copies, we usually always end up with the src or dst
being system memory, meaning we can't only rely on the identity map and
will also need to emit PTEs and so will always require a TLB flush.

f4c75f975c drm/sched: Document race condition in drm_sched_fini()
In drm_sched_fini() all entities are marked as stopped - without taking
the appropriate lock, because that would deadlock. That means that
drm_sched_fini() and drm_sched_entity_push_job() can race against each
other.

This should most likely be fixed by establishing the rule that all
entities associated with a scheduler must be torn down first. Then,
however, the locking should be removed from drm_sched_fini() alltogether
with an appropriate comment.
